Several factors influence the cost of a concrete slab with contractors in San Francisco. The size and desired thickness of the slab are primary cost drivers, along with the accessibility of the job site. If significant excavation or site preparation is needed, that will add to the expense. The type of concrete mix used, and whether any reinforcement like rebar is required, also impacts the price. For patio pavers in San Francisco, the base preparation is often more critical than the paver material itself. A properly compacted gravel base and a layer of sand are essential for stability and drainage, especially given the local climate. The pavers themselves can be made from various materials like concrete, brick, or natural stone. When considering concrete pavers, look for durable, weather-resistant options designed for outdoor use. The installation method by a skilled contractor is key to ensuring your San Francisco patio remains beautiful and functional for years to come.
